3h ago

Senior Software Engineer, App Performance - Core UI

San Mateo, CA, United States

$196,750-$243,290 / year

full-timeseniorgaming

Tech Stack

Description

You will profile, diagnose, and optimize rendering, layout, and input pipelines across platforms to reduce frame time and eliminate jank. You'll design and build extensible systems for core surfaces used by hundreds of millions of users, collaborating with engineering, product, and design teams to raise the bar on UI performance.

Requirements

  • 5+ years of software development experience building large-scale, user-facing frontend applications
  • Deep expertise in modern frontend technologies (React or similar, component-based architecture, state management)
  • Demonstrated ability to optimize frontend performance and diagnose issues using profiling and benchmarking techniques
  • Strong understanding of software design principles and frontend architecture (clean APIs, module boundaries)
  • Excellent communication and collaboration skills for cross-functional work

Responsibilities

  • Own profiling, diagnosis, and end-to-end optimization of rendering, layout, and input pipelines across mobile, desktop, VR, and consoles
  • Design and build robust, extensible systems powering Roblox's core surfaces (Home, Avatar, Search, etc.)
  • Create scalable solutions for high-fidelity, high-performance interfaces
  • Partner with engineering, product, and design teams to integrate shared solutions
  • Collaborate with senior engineers and tech leads to shape architectural direction
0 views 0 saves 0 applications